About The Lord of the Rings: The Return of the King In Concert

Currently, The Lord of the Rings: The Return of the King In Concert tours various cities, with performances scheduled throughout 2023 and into 2024. Major orchestras, including the London Philharmonic and the Los Angeles Philharmonic, have taken part in these events, drawing large crowds eager to relive the magic of Middle-earth. The concerts often feature renowned guest conductors and soloists, enhancing the overall performance experience. Additionally, many venues are embracing innovative technology to elevate the concert experience, including high-definition projections and enhanced sound systems that immerse the audience in both the music and the film. Special events, such as Q&A sessions with film cast members and behind-the-scenes discussions, are also becoming more common, adding an extra layer of engagement for fans. The concerts have been praised not only for their artistic quality but also for their ability to bring together communities of fans, fostering a shared appreciation for Tolkien's work and its adaptation into film. With the ongoing interest in live event performances, The Return of the King In Concert continues to thrive, promising an unforgettable experience for both new and longtime fans of the franchise.

The Lord of the Rings: The Return of the King In Concert History

The Lord of the Rings: The Return of the King In Concert is a live orchestral performance that showcases the final installment of Peter Jackson's acclaimed film trilogy based on J.R.R. Tolkien's epic fantasy novel. The concert experience first emerged shortly after the film's release in 2003, capturing the imagination of audiences worldwide. The music for the trilogy, composed by Howard Shore, plays a pivotal role in the emotional depth and storytelling of the films. Shore's score for The Return of the King won an Academy Award, and the concert version allows fans to experience this powerful music performed live by a full orchestra and choir, often accompanied by a screening of the film. Over the years, these concerts have been held in major cities around the globe, attracting a diverse audience of film enthusiasts, music lovers, and Tolkien fans alike. The combination of live orchestration with the visual spectacle of the film creates a unique and immersive experience that transports attendees into the heart of Middle-earth. As the popularity of film concerts continues to rise, The Return of the King In Concert has become a staple in the repertoire of symphonic events, celebrated for its ability to connect audiences with the timeless themes of heroism, friendship, and sacrifice that resonate throughout the story.
